引言

欧拉(Leonhard Euler)是18世纪最伟大的数学家之一,被誉为“数学王子”。他的成就不仅在数学领域产生了深远的影响,而且对物理学、天文学、工程学等领域也有着重要的贡献。本文将揭秘欧拉的一生及其在数学领域的卓越贡献。

欧拉生平简介

早年经历

欧拉出生于瑞士巴塞尔,他的父亲是一位数学教授。在欧拉年仅13岁时,他的父亲去世,但他仍然在数学方面展现出了非凡的天赋。后来,欧拉进入了巴塞尔大学学习哲学和神学,但他的兴趣主要集中在数学和物理学上。

学术生涯

欧拉在学术生涯中取得了许多成就。他曾在圣彼得堡科学院工作,并在那里与拉格朗日等科学家合作。后来,由于健康原因,他回到巴塞尔,并在那里继续他的研究工作。

主要贡献

1. 概率论

欧拉在概率论方面做出了许多贡献,包括提出了著名的欧拉公式。欧拉公式是复数指数函数的一个重要公式,它将三角函数与复数指数函数联系起来。

import cmath

# 欧拉公式
def euler_formula(x):
    return cmath.exp(1j * x)

# 示例
print(euler_formula(0))  # 结果为1
print(euler_formula(pi))  # 结果为-1

2. 数学分析

欧拉在数学分析领域也有许多重要贡献,包括提出了欧拉积分公式和欧拉恒等式。欧拉积分公式是求解某些类型积分的一种方法,而欧拉恒等式则是将三角函数和复数指数函数联系起来的另一个重要公式。

from sympy import symbols, integrate, pi

# 欧拉积分公式示例
x = symbols('x')
integral = integrate(e**x, (x, 0, 1))
print(integral)  # 结果为e-1

3. 几何学

欧拉在几何学方面也有许多贡献,包括提出了欧拉线、欧拉公式等。欧拉线是指通过一个三角形的重心、外心和垂心的直线,而欧拉公式则是将球面几何与平面几何联系起来的公式。

4. 应用数学

欧拉在应用数学方面也有许多贡献,包括提出了欧拉方法求解微分方程。欧拉方法是一种数值方法,用于求解常微分方程。

结论

欧拉是一位伟大的数学家,他的成就不仅对数学领域产生了深远的影响,而且对其他科学领域也有着重要的贡献。他的思想和方法至今仍然被广泛应用于各个领域。通过对欧拉的研究,我们可以更好地理解数学的魅力和力量。